## Break-Glass Access: EXIF Scrubber (Pinewick)

Reviewers: the EXIF scrubbing service in Pinewick strips GPS, serial, and timestamp tags before upload. If the scrubber's signing vault seals during deploy, normal credentials will not unseal it. Break-glass access is logged and requires a second approver within one hour. Verify the audit entry before proceeding. Once both approvals are recorded, unseal using the recovery passphrase shown directly below.

unlock words, tajeg-bajeg: jorox-gilok-briir-holiel-jorath

Welcome to the Nocturne Support rotation at Veldrith Systems. Between 22:00 and 06:00, the main atrium doors at the Harrowgate office are locked, so night-shift staff must enter through the east service corridor. Sign the overnight register at the security desk before heading upstairs, and keep your lanyard visible at all times. The corridor door requires the current night-access code, which is listed below for your reference.

turnstile pass: bdg-TXR-4

Runbook: Scanline barcode bridge

If warehouse scans stop flowing into Cartwheel, it's almost always the bridge service on the Dunmore floor box wedging after a USB hiccup. Bounce the service first — nine times out of ten that fixes it. If not, check the queue depth before escalating. When restarting, make sure the bridge comes up with these settings.

deployment values, yafop-bajef:
[gilok]
team = ulaius
access_code = ac_423664
host = gilok.sivrelhq.corp
port = 9200
owner = pelius.istax
peer = eliok.torvasoft.internal